9Performance Metrics for Comparison of Heuristics Task Scheduling Algorithms in Cloud Computing Platform
Nidhi Rajak* and Ranjit Rajak
Department of Computer Science and Applications, Dr. Harisingh Gour Central University Sagar, M.P.
Abstract
Cloud computing is a recent demanding technology and infrastructure paradigm which is using in every field of science and technology. This technology is based on the Internet and apply one principle “pay and usage of computing resources”. Scheduling of the tasks is burning area of research in cloud, and it can be defined as the process of mapping of tasks onto the virtual machines and it should give overall minimum scheduling length that is minimize the overall execution time on cloud servers. Here, a very specific graph which is used and is called as Directed Acyclic Graph (DAG) represents of an application in the scheduling problem. A DAG is stated as the collection tasks and communication links with their value. This chapter studies four well-known heuristics of task scheduling algorithms such as HEFT, CPOP, ALAP, and PETS and finds their comparison studies based on performance metrics such as scheduling length, speedup, efficiency, resource utilization, and cost.
Keywords: DAG, upward rank, downward rank, cloud computing, speedup
9.1 Introduction
Technology is dynamic and it is changing present requirements which are prospective to future demands. Computing capability is growing at a rapid speed in every field and should be solved ...
Get Machine Learning Approach for Cloud Data Analytics in IoT now with the O’Reilly learning platform.
O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.